Document: in a 1x50 base pair single-read configuration in Rapid Run mode, with a total of at least 120 million reads per lane. Sequence reads were trimmed to remove adapter sequences and poor quality nucleotides (error rate <0.05) at the ends. Sequence reads shorter than 50 nucleotides were discarded.
